How Much Does a Bachelor’s in Physics from Agnes Scott Cost?

$44,250 Average Tuition and Fees (In-State)

Agnes Scott Undergraduate Tuition and Fees

Part-time undergraduates at Agnes Scott paid an average of $1,830 per credit hour in 2019-2020. This tuition was the same for both in-state and out-of-state students. Information about average full-time undergraduate tuition and fees is shown in the table below.

In StateOut of State
Tuition$43,920$43,920
Fees$330$330
Books and Supplies$1,000$1,000
On Campus Room and Board$13,050$13,050
On Campus Other Expenses$1,145$1,145

Agnes Scott Bachelor’s Student Diversity for Physics

4 Bachelor's Degrees Awarded
100.0% Women
There were 4 bachelor’s degrees in physics awarded during the 2019-2020 academic year. Information about those students is shown below.

Male-to-Female Ratio

All of the students who received their BS in physics in 2019-2020 were women.
